Summary

Dr. Gene Kim specializes in cardiovascular disease and internal medicine, bringing 25 years of experience to his practice. He earned his medical degree from the University of Chicago Division of Biological Sciences Pritzker School of Medicine. Dr. Kim is fluent in both English and Spanish.

Dr. Kim practices at The University of Chicago Medicine in Chicago, Illinois, with additional affiliations at Montefiore Hospital, UChicago Medicine Crown Point, and The Center for Care and Discovery. He focuses on treating heart conditions such as heart failure and atrial fibrillation, along with various heart rhythm disorders. His expertise includes performing electrocardiograms to monitor heart function and conducting comprehensive blood work to assess overall health.
